阿里云 对象存储,阿里云对象存储深度解析,环境变量配置与最佳实践
- 综合资讯
- 2024-11-08 20:55:09
- 2

阿里云对象存储深度解析涵盖环境变量配置与最佳实践,旨在帮助用户高效使用存储服务。本文详细解析了配置步骤,并提供实用技巧,助力优化存储性能与成本。...
阿里云对象存储深度解析涵盖环境变量配置与最佳实践,旨在帮助用户高效使用存储服务。本文详细解析了配置步骤,并提供实用技巧,助力优化存储性能与成本。
随着互联网技术的飞速发展,数据存储需求日益增长,对象存储作为一种新兴的存储技术,因其高扩展性、低成本、易管理等特点,逐渐成为企业数据存储的首选方案,阿里云对象存储(OSS)作为国内领先的云存储服务,为广大用户提供稳定、高效、安全的存储服务,本文将深入解析阿里云对象存储的环境变量配置,并结合实际应用场景,分享最佳实践。
阿里云对象存储概述
阿里云对象存储(OSS)是一种基于云的对象存储服务,旨在为用户提供一个安全、可靠、可扩展的存储空间,用户可以将任意类型的数据存储在OSS上,包括图片、文档、视频等,OSS具有以下特点:
1、高可用性:阿里云在全球范围内拥有多个数据中心,确保数据的高可用性。
2、可扩展性:用户可以根据需求随时调整存储空间,满足业务快速发展的需求。
3、安全性:阿里云采用多重安全机制,确保用户数据的安全。
4、易用性:提供丰富的API和SDK,方便用户进行操作。
环境变量配置
环境变量是计算机系统中用于存储配置信息的变量,它可以在程序运行过程中被读取和修改,在阿里云对象存储中,环境变量主要用于配置存储空间(Bucket)的相关信息,如域名、访问密钥等,以下是阿里云对象存储中常见的环境变量配置:
1、OSS_ACCESS_KEY_ID:存储空间的访问密钥ID,用于身份验证。
2、OSS_ACCESS_KEY_SECRET:存储空间的访问密钥密钥,用于身份验证。
3、OSS_ENDPOINT:存储空间所在的数据中心地址,用于API请求。
4、OSS_BUCKET:存储空间名称,用于标识不同的存储空间。
5、OSS_IS_CNAME:是否启用自定义域名,用于配置自定义域名。
以下是一个简单的环境变量配置示例:
export OSS_ACCESS_KEY_ID="your_access_key_id" export OSS_ACCESS_KEY_SECRET="your_access_key_secret" export OSS_ENDPOINT="https://your_oss_endpoint" export OSS_BUCKET="your_bucket_name" export OSS_IS_CNAME="true"
最佳实践
1、安全配置:确保OSS访问密钥的安全,避免泄露,定期更换访问密钥,并限制访问权限。
2、高可用性:合理规划存储空间,将数据分散存储在不同数据中心,提高数据可用性。
3、可扩展性:根据业务需求,合理调整存储空间容量,确保业务持续发展。
4、自定义域名:配置自定义域名,提高品牌形象,方便用户访问。
5、API调用优化:合理使用API,避免频繁请求,降低请求成本。
6、数据备份与恢复:定期备份数据,确保数据安全,在数据丢失时,能够快速恢复。
7、监控与告警:开启OSS监控,实时了解存储空间的使用情况,及时发现异常并进行处理。
阿里云对象存储作为一款优秀的云存储服务,具有诸多优势,通过合理配置环境变量,用户可以轻松实现数据存储、管理、访问等操作,本文深入解析了阿里云对象存储的环境变量配置,并结合实际应用场景,分享了最佳实践,希望对广大用户有所帮助。
本文链接:https://www.zhitaoyun.cn/690131.html
发表评论